Kitchen Remodel Cost Overview in Clarksville

The cost of kitchen remodeling in Clarksville, Tennessee can vary widely due to the specific materials chosen, labor rates, size of the project, and other factors. On average, a full kitchen remodel in this area typically costs around $30,000, but this range can extend from as low as $12,000 for basic updates to over $64,500 for more comprehensive renovations. These prices reflect local market conditions and the unique demands of Southeastern construction.

Local factors such as the type of materials selected, the complexity of the design, the size of the kitchen, and the current season can significantly influence the final cost. For instance, using locally sourced or high-end materials might increase costs, while seasonal fluctuations in labor availability could lead to price variations. Additionally, permits required by local building codes are an essential but often overlooked aspect that adds to the overall expense.

Factors That Affect Kitchen Remodel Cost in Clarksville

The cost of kitchen remodeling in Clarksville can be influenced by several key factors:

  • Materials: The choice between basic cabinetry or custom woodwork can dramatically affect costs. High-quality granite countertops and stainless steel appliances are also significant contributors to the overall budget.
  • Labor: Skilled labor rates in Clarksville vary, with more experienced contractors commanding higher fees. Specialized tasks like plumbing upgrades may also add to the cost due to increased labor complexity.
  • Size and Complexity: Larger kitchens naturally require more materials and time, potentially raising the total expense. Complex designs that include intricate layouts or unique features can increase costs further.
  • Season: The timing of your project might affect pricing; for example, during peak seasons like spring and summer, demand for renovations may drive up costs due to higher labor rates and material availability.
  • Permits: Depending on the extent of changes, you might need local permits. These can add extra expenses and delays, especially if they are time-consuming to obtain or involve additional inspections.

Tips to Save Money on Kitchen Remodel in Clarksville

Pro Tip

Always get at least 3 quotes from licensed contractors in Clarksville before starting your project. Comparing bids can save you 10–30% on kitchen remodel costs.

To save money on your kitchen remodel in Clarksville, consider these strategic tips:

  • Plan Ahead: Conduct thorough research on materials and contractors before starting. This can help you negotiate better prices and avoid unexpected costs.
  • Opt for DIY Projects: For tasks like painting or installing shelves, consider doing it yourself to save on labor expenses. Local home improvement workshops can offer guidance and supplies at lower rates than professional services.
  • Budget Flexibly: Allocate some of your budget towards contingencies, which can cover unexpected issues that often arise during remodeling projects. This helps maintain control over the project without going overboard.
  • Timing is Key: Renovations are less expensive outside peak seasons. Consider scheduling your remodel for times when contractors have lower workloads and may offer discounts or reduced rates.
